The nacho cheese recipe below is the very basic version of nacho cheese, which you can customize or embellish in many different ways. Try substituting half of the cheddar with pepper jack, or stirring in a 4oz. can of diced green chiles. Experiment with the seasonings by adding a pinch of garlic powder, cumin, or even cayenne pepper. Stir in a few sliced green onions, or a can of Rotel tomatoes (drained). You can really have fun with this one.

5 Minute Nacho Cheese Sauce

nacho cheese recipe

This rich and tangy homemade nacho cheese only takes about 5 minutes to make and uses only real, simple ingredients.

Total: 5min

Yield: 6

Serving Size: 1 Serving

Nutrition Facts: servingSize 1 Serving, calories 183.1 kcal, Carbohydrate 4.92 g, Protein 8.13 g, Fat 14.65 g, Fiber 0.32 g, Sodium 337.23 mg

Ingredients:

  • 2 Tbsp butter ($0.22)
  • 2 Tbsp flour ($0.02)
  • 1 cup whole milk ($0.30)
  • 6 oz. medium cheddar, shredded (about 1.5 cups) ($2.25)
  • 1/4 tsp salt ($0.02)
  • 1/4 tsp chili powder ($0.02)

Instruction:

  1. Add the butter and flour to a small sauce pot. Heat and whisk the butter and flour together until they become bubbly and foamy. Continue to cook and whisk the bubbly mixture for about 60 seconds.
  2. Whisk the milk into the flour and butter mixture. Turn the heat up slightly and allow the milk to come to a simmer while whisking. When it reaches a simmer, the mixture will thicken. Once it’s thick enough to coat a spoon, turn off the heat.
  3. Stir in the shredded cheddar, one handful at a time, until melted into the sauce. If needed, place the pot over a low flame to help the cheese melt. Do not overheat the cheese sauce.
  4. Once all the cheese is melted into the sauce, stir in the salt and chili powder. Taste and adjust the seasoning as needed. If the sauce becomes too thick, simply whisk in an additional splash of milk.

Quick and Easy Nacho Cheese Recipe

nacho cheese recipe

This nacho cheese sauce is sharp and creamy, and everything you ever dreamed of smothering over nachos, veggies, or a giant pretzel.

Prep: 5min

Total: 10min

Yield: 8

Serving Size: 0.25 cup

Nutrition Facts: servingSize 0.25 cup, calories 203 kcal

Ingredients:

  • 3 cups (12oz) freshly shredded sharp cheddar cheese (*)
  • 1 1/2 teaspoons cornstarch
  • 1 12-ounce can (1 1/2 cups) evaporated milk
  • 2 teaspoons hot sauce (optional)
  • 1/8 teaspoon salt
  • 1/8 teaspoon ground cayenne pepper (plus more as needed)

Instruction:

  1. In a large bowl, combine shredded cheese and cornstarch and toss to coat.
  2. To a medium saucepan, add evaporated milk. Heat over medium heat, stirring occasionally until milk just begins to simmer.
  3. Remove the milk from heat and stir in the cheese, a large handful at a time, until all the cheese has been incorporated and it has completely melted into the sauce.
  4. Add hot sauce, salt, and cayenne, and then taste and add more if needed. Serve over nachos, fries, or steamed vegetables and enjoy!
